Cordless Power Tool Solutions

Various types of power tools are marketed for a wide range of applications, from household to professional use. Recently, the adoption of high-capacity lithium-ion batteries has led to a shift to cordless types that are compact, light, easy to carry, and easy to work with, not only for household use but also for professional use, such as hammer drills, impact wrenches, nailers, staplers, and round saws. The capability of cordless power tools to operate for longer time periods with a single charge is one of the major qualities for users when choosing products. Toshiba's lineup of MOSFET, motor control drivers, photocouplers, and other products that use current technologies helps designers make efficient use of limited battery capacities.

DTMOSIV Series MOSFETs

Toshiba DTMOSIV MOSFETs use the state-of-the-art single epitaxial process, which provides a 30% reduction in RDS(on), a figure of merit (FOM) for MOSFETs, compared to its predecessor, DTMOSIII. This reduction in the RDS(on) makes it possible to house lower RDS(on) chips in the same packages. This helps to improve efficiency and reduce the size of power supplies. Toshiba DTMOSIV MOSFETs are ideal for use with switching regulators.
